Police launch appeal after woman reported being sexually assaulted in Fife

An appeal for information has been launched by police after a woman reported being sexually assaulted in a Fife village at the weekend.

The incident reportedly happened around 8.30pm on Saturday (18 December 2021) within a car park at the Durie Vale Roundabout in Windygates.

Officers say that the 42-year-old woman was left shaken as a result of the incident.

A description of the suspect is a white man in his late 30s with short dark hair and was wearing a dark t-shirt and light blue jeans.

He was driving a dark coloured Saloon car on the A916, Cupar Road between Bonnybank and Kennoway.

DC Andrew Robertson, from Levenmouth CID at Police Scotland, said: "Enquiries are continuing to establish the full circumstances surrounding this incident and we are appealing to anyone who may be able to assist with our investigation.

"If you were in the area of Durie Vale Roundabout or travelled between Windygates and Bonnybank around the time of the incident, please come forward and speak with officers.

"I would also ask for anyone with possible dashcam or CCTV footage in the area to contact police."
